A concentration in Health Promotion and Behavior equips you with a comprehensive understanding of the determinants of health and the skills necessary to direct programming efforts at influencing or facilitation health-related behavior, advocating public health policy, creating supportive environments, strengthening community action and reorienting health services in order to improve quality of life.

A focus in Health Promotion and Behavior prepares you to:

  • Design, implement, and evaluate behavior change programs for a variety of health-related behaviors, including alcohol, tobacco, and other substance use, physical activity, diet, sexual behavior, and cancer screening.
  • Perform community needs assessments
  • Apply social marketing programs toward the modification of unhealthily lifestyle behaviors

Work setting options for the MPH graduate with a concentration in Health Promotion and Behavior:

  • Health departments
  • Local, state, and federal government agencies
  • Medical centers
  • Colleges and Universities
  • Non-profit organizations
  • International organizations
  • Commercial firms
  • Consulting firms

Typical Health Promotion and Behavior positions:

  • Public Health Education
  • Health Promotion Program Coordinator
  • Health Promotion Program Evaluator
  • Health Promotion Specialist
  • Director, Community Health and Wellness
  • Manager, Community-based Initiatives
  • Supervisor of Health Education and Wellness
  • Sexual Violence Prevention Program Coordinator
